DTC P0116/16500: ECT Sensor Circuit Range/Performance

NOTE: DTC is set when Electronic Control Module (ECM) detects Engine Coolant Temperature (ECT) sensor is out of range or performance is poor.
  1. Ensure ignition is off. Allow engine to cool to at least 86°F (30°C). Disconnect ECT sensor connector. Connect ohmmeter to ECT sensor terminals. Run engine at idle.
  2. While engine is running, sensor resistance should decline slowly without interruption to about 275-375 ohms. If sensor resistance stops moving before operating temperature has been reached, or if a resistance of at least 400 ohms is not reached, replace ECT sensor.
